GIC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2025 in Review

130 of the 7,458 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Global Industrial (GIC) for Q1 2025, worth a combined $290M — down 9.2% from $320M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 25 funds opened new GIC positions and 22 closed out — a net gain of 3 holders — while 56 added to existing stakes and 33 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Fidelity Investments, adding an estimated $12.8M. The largest seller was Mawer Investment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$28.3M sold.
